David Pastrnak scored two goals as the Boston Bruins picked up another two points in the standings Saturday afternoon with a 3-1 win over the NY Islanders.

Those two points put the B's back in first place in their Atlantic Division.(39-23-8 (85 points)

The two Pastrnak goals plus a goal and two assists from Loui Eriksson was more than enough for Bruins goalie Tuukka Rask. He made 25 saves in the win.

The B's will spend the next week on a tough west coast roadtrip with games at San Jose, Anaheim and LA.
